Twitch SDK (Internal)
ttv::broadcast::IngestTester Member List

This is the complete list of members for ttv::broadcast::IngestTester, including all inherited members.

AddListener(const std::shared_ptr< IIngestTesterListener > &listener)ttv::broadcast::IngestTester
Cancel() overridettv::broadcast::IngestTestervirtual
CheckShutdown() overridettv::broadcast::IngestTesterprotectedvirtual
CompleteShutdown() overridettv::broadcast::IngestTesterprotectedvirtual
CompleteTask(Task *task)ttv::Componentprotected
Component()ttv::Componentprotected
Dispose()ttv::broadcast::IngestTester
DisposerFunc typedefttv::broadcast::IngestTester
GetIngestServer(IngestServer &result) const overridettv::broadcast::IngestTestervirtual
GetLoggerName() const overridettv::broadcast::IngestTestervirtual
GetMeasuredKbps(uint32_t &result) overridettv::broadcast::IngestTestervirtual
GetProgress(float &result) const overridettv::broadcast::IngestTestervirtual
GetState() const overridettv::Componentvirtual
GetTaskRunner()ttv::Componentinline
GetTestDurationMilliseconds(uint64_t &result) const overridettv::broadcast::IngestTestervirtual
GetTestError(TTV_ErrorCode &result) overridettv::broadcast::IngestTestervirtual
GetTestState(TestState &result) const overridettv::broadcast::IngestTestervirtual
GetUserId(UserId &result) const overridettv::broadcast::IngestTestervirtual
IngestTester(const std::shared_ptr< User > &user, const std::shared_ptr< StreamerContext > &streamerContext)ttv::broadcast::IngestTester
Initialize() overridettv::broadcast::IngestTestervirtual
IsDone() constttv::broadcast::IngestTesterprivate
IsTaskRunning(Task *task) constttv::Componentprotected
Log(TTV_MessageLevel level, const char *format,...)ttv::UserComponentprotected
mBroadcastingttv::broadcast::IngestTesterprivate
mComponentContainerttv::broadcast::IngestTesterprivate
mDisposerFuncttv::broadcast::IngestTesterprivate
mIngestServerttv::broadcast::IngestTesterprivate
mListenersttv::broadcast::IngestTesterprivate
mMeasuredKbpsttv::broadcast::IngestTesterprivate
mOAuthIssuettv::UserComponentprotected
mProgressttv::broadcast::IngestTesterprivate
mRunningTasksttv::Componentprotected
mSampleDatattv::broadcast::IngestTesterprivate
mServerTestTimerttv::broadcast::IngestTesterprivate
mShutdownTimeMillisecondsttv::Componentprotected
mStartingBytesSentttv::broadcast::IngestTesterprivate
mStatettv::Componentprotected
mStatsListenerttv::broadcast::IngestTesterprivate
mStreamerttv::broadcast::IngestTesterprivate
mStreamerContextttv::broadcast::IngestTesterprivate
mStreamerListenerttv::broadcast::IngestTesterprivate
mTaskMutexttv::Componentmutableprotected
mTaskRunnerttv::Componentprotected
mTestDurationMillisecondsttv::broadcast::IngestTesterprivate
mTestErrorCodettv::broadcast::IngestTesterprivate
mTestStatettv::broadcast::IngestTesterprivate
mTotalBytesSentttv::broadcast::IngestTesterprivate
mTotalVideoPacketsSentttv::broadcast::IngestTesterprivate
mUserttv::UserComponentprotected
mVideoCapturerttv::broadcast::IngestTesterprivate
mVideoEncoderttv::broadcast::IngestTesterprivate
mVideoParamsttv::broadcast::IngestTesterprivate
mWaitingForStartCallbackttv::broadcast::IngestTesterprivate
mWaitingForStopCallbackttv::broadcast::IngestTesterprivate
OnStreamerStarted()ttv::broadcast::IngestTesterprivate
OnStreamerStopped()ttv::broadcast::IngestTesterprivate
OnUserAuthenticationIssue(std::shared_ptr< const OAuthToken > oauthToken, TTV_ErrorCode ec)ttv::UserComponentprotectedvirtual
OnUserInfoFetchComplete(TTV_ErrorCode ec)ttv::UserComponentprotectedvirtual
OnUserLogInComplete(TTV_ErrorCode ec)ttv::UserComponentprotectedvirtual
OnUserLogOutComplete(TTV_ErrorCode ec)ttv::UserComponentprotectedvirtual
RemoveListener(const std::shared_ptr< IIngestTesterListener > &listener)ttv::broadcast::IngestTester
SetClientState(State state)ttv::Componentprotectedvirtual
SetDisposer(DisposerFunc &&func)ttv::broadcast::IngestTesterinline
SetServerState(State state)ttv::Componentprotectedvirtual
SetState(State state)ttv::Componentprotectedvirtual
SetTaskRunner(std::shared_ptr< TaskRunner > taskRunner)ttv::Componentvirtual
SetTestData(const uint8_t *buffer, uint32_t length)ttv::broadcast::IngestTester
SetTestDurationMilliseconds(uint64_t duration) overridettv::broadcast::IngestTestervirtual
SetTestState(TestState state)ttv::broadcast::IngestTesterprivate
Shutdown() overridettv::broadcast::IngestTestervirtual
Start(const IngestServer &ingestServer) overridettv::broadcast::IngestTestervirtual
StartServerTest()ttv::broadcast::IngestTesterprivate
StartTask(std::shared_ptr< Task > task)ttv::Componentprotected
State enum namettv::IComponent
StopServerTest()ttv::broadcast::IngestTesterprivate
TestState enum namettv::broadcast::IIngestTester
Update() overridettv::broadcast::IngestTestervirtual
UpdateProgress()ttv::broadcast::IngestTesterprivate
UpdateServerTest()ttv::broadcast::IngestTesterprivate
UserComponent(const std::shared_ptr< User > &user)ttv::UserComponent
~Component()ttv::Componentvirtual
~IIngestTester()ttv::broadcast::IIngestTestervirtual
~IngestTester()ttv::broadcast::IngestTestervirtual